Get in Touch** The Honda repair market for Martinsville residents is characterized by a reliance on regional specialists rather than in-town exclusivity. Martinsville itself offers several competent general mechanics but lacks a shop that explicitly markets itself as a Honda performance or hybrid specialist. For routine maintenance (oil changes, tire rotations), local shops are a convenient and cost-effective choice. However, for the specialized services requested—particularly VTEC, hybrid systems, SH-AWD, and advanced diagnostics—residents must look to the broader Indianapolis metropolitan area. The competition for this high-skill work is concentrated among the dealerships and top-tier independent shops in Indianapolis and its southern suburbs, like Mooresville.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a clear tiered structure. Local Martinsville/Mooresville independents (like Pit Stop) offer the most competitive labor rates. Indianapolis independents specializing in imports (like Dellen Automotive) fall in the mid-range, providing a balance of expertise and value. Dealerships (like Tom Wood Honda) command the highest labor rates but provide factory-certified technicians, guaranteed OEM parts, and direct access to Honda corporate technical support, which is often necessary for the most complex issues.

In Martinsville, we frequently service Honda vehicles for issues like faulty power window regulators, worn-out suspension components from our rural and sometimes uneven roads, and check engine lights related to oxygen sensors. The seasonal temperature shifts and road salt used in winter can also accelerate corrosion and battery issues.
Look for a shop with ASE-certified technicians, specifically those with Honda or Japanese import experience. In Martinsville, seek out long-established local shops with strong community reviews, and ask if they use genuine Honda parts or high-quality aftermarket equivalents for repairs.
Seek professional service for complex systems like the transmission, hybrid battery (on models like the Civic Hybrid), or advanced diagnostics for persistent check engine lights. For Martinsville drivers, issues affecting safety or reliability—like brake repairs or steering problems on our highways—should always be handled by a professional.
Typically, independent repair shops in Martinsville offer more competitive labor rates than dealerships located in larger cities like Indianapolis or Bloomington. However, always request a detailed estimate upfront, as parts costs can be similar, and the expertise of a specialist can provide better long-term value.
Given our Indiana climate, prioritize seasonal services like thorough undercarriage washes to combat winter road salt corrosion and more frequent cabin air filter changes due to pollen and farm dust. Also, have your battery tested before winter, as cold snaps can reveal weak batteries in otherwise reliable Hondas.
